Ingredients:

1 1/2 cups old fashioned oats
1 cup organic rice milk(or water)
1 teaspoon baking powder
3 large egg whites
1/2 teaspoon (I used more)

Directions:

COOKING!!
1. Heat rice milk until hot. Add oats and set aside (add protein optional)

2. Mix remaining dry ingredients & add oatmeal mixture.

3. Add egg whites and mix until well blended. I used blender for a smoother batter but that is optional! The batter may be thick and if you would like to thin it out add more rice milk or water.

4.Cook on a hot griddle and spray Pam before.

5. There are so many options for the toppings! Nuts, Fruits, Agave syrup, etc. I used sliced bananas, sun-flower seed butter,honey, and cinnamon.
